37 /*
38  * Beware PXA27x bugs:
39  *
40  *   o Slot 12 read from modem space will hang controller.
41  *   o CDONE, SDONE interrupt fails after any slot 12 IO.
42  *
43  * We therefore have an hybrid approach for waiting on SDONE (interrupt or
44  * 1 jiffy timeout if interrupt never comes).
45  */
46 
47 unsigned short pxa2xx_ac97_read(struct snd_ac97 *ac97, unsigned short reg)
48 {
49 	unsigned short val = -1;
50 	volatile u32 *reg_addr;
51 
52 	mutex_lock(&car_mutex);
53 
54 	/* set up primary or secondary codec space */
55 	if (cpu_is_pxa25x() && reg == AC97_GPIO_STATUS)
56 		reg_addr = ac97->num ? &SMC_REG_BASE : &PMC_REG_BASE;
57 	else
58 		reg_addr = ac97->num ? &SAC_REG_BASE : &PAC_REG_BASE;
59 	reg_addr += (reg >> 1);
60 
61 	/* start read access across the ac97 link */
62 	GSR = GSR_CDONE | GSR_SDONE;
63 	gsr_bits = 0;
64 	val = *reg_addr;
65 	if (reg == AC97_GPIO_STATUS)
66 		goto out;
67 	if (wait_event_timeout(gsr_wq, (GSR | gsr_bits) & GSR_SDONE, 1) <= 0 &&
68 	    !((GSR | gsr_bits) & GSR_SDONE)) {
69 		printk(KERN_ERR "%s: read error (ac97_reg=%d GSR=%#lx)\n",
70 				__func__, reg, GSR | gsr_bits);
71 		val = -1;
72 		goto out;
73 	}
74 
75 	/* valid data now */
76 	GSR = GSR_CDONE | GSR_SDONE;
77 	gsr_bits = 0;
78 	val = *reg_addr;
79 	/* but we've just started another cycle... */
80 	wait_event_timeout(gsr_wq, (GSR | gsr_bits) & GSR_SDONE, 1);
81 
82 out:	mutex_unlock(&car_mutex);
83 	return val;
84 }
85 E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(pxa2xx_ac97_read);
86 
87 void pxa2xx_ac97_write(struct snd_ac97 *ac97, unsigned short reg,
88 			unsigned short val)
89 {
90 	volatile u32 *reg_addr;
91 
92 	mutex_lock(&car_mutex);
93 
94 	/* set up primary or secondary codec space */
95 	if (cpu_is_pxa25x() && reg == AC97_GPIO_STATUS)
96 		reg_addr = ac97->num ? &SMC_REG_BASE : &PMC_REG_BASE;
97 	else
98 		reg_addr = ac97->num ? &SAC_REG_BASE : &PAC_REG_BASE;
99 	reg_addr += (reg >> 1);
100 
101 	GSR = GSR_CDONE | GSR_SDONE;
102 	gsr_bits = 0;
103 	*reg_addr = val;
104 	if (wait_event_timeout(gsr_wq, (GSR | gsr_bits) & GSR_CDONE, 1) <= 0 &&
105 	    !((GSR | gsr_bits) & GSR_CDONE))
106 		printk(KERN_ERR "%s: write error (ac97_reg=%d GSR=%#lx)\n",
107 				__func__, reg, GSR | gsr_bits);
108 
109 	mutex_unlock(&car_mutex);
110 }
111 E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(pxa2xx_ac97_write);

113 #ifdef CONFIG_PXA25x
114 static inline void pxa_ac97_warm_pxa25x(void)
115 {
116 	gsr_bits = 0;
117 
118 	GCR |= GCR_WARM_RST | GCR_PRIRDY_IEN | GCR_SECRDY_IEN;
119 	wait_event_timeout(gsr_wq, gsr_bits & (GSR_PCR | GSR_SCR), 1);
120 }
121 
122 static inline void pxa_ac97_cold_pxa25x(void)
123 {
124 	GCR &=  GCR_COLD_RST;  /* clear everything but nCRST */
125 	GCR &= ~GCR_COLD_RST;  /* then assert nCRST */
126 
127 	gsr_bits = 0;
128 
129 	GCR = GCR_COLD_RST;
130 	GCR |= GCR_CDONE_IE|GCR_SDONE_IE;
131 	wait_event_timeout(gsr_wq, gsr_bits & (GSR_PCR | GSR_SCR), 1);
132 }
133 #endif
134 
135 #ifdef CONFIG_PXA27x
136 static inline void pxa_ac97_warm_pxa27x(void)
137 {
138 	gsr_bits = 0;
139 
140 	/* warm reset broken on Bulverde, so manually keep AC97 reset high */
141 	pxa27x_assert_ac97reset(reset_gpio, 1);
142 	udelay(10);
143 	GCR |= GCR_WARM_RST;
144 	pxa27x_assert_ac97reset(reset_gpio, 0);
145 	udelay(500);
146 }
147 
148 static inline void pxa_ac97_cold_pxa27x(void)
149 {
150 	GCR &=  GCR_COLD_RST;  /* clear everything but nCRST */
151 	GCR &= ~GCR_COLD_RST;  /* then assert nCRST */
152 
153 	gsr_bits = 0;
154 
155 	/* PXA27x Developers Manual section 13.5.2.2.1 */
156 	clk_enable(ac97conf_clk);
157 	udelay(5);
158 	clk_disable(ac97conf_clk);
159 	GCR = GCR_COLD_RST;
160 	udelay(50);
161 }
162 #endif
163 
164 #ifdef CONFIG_PXA3xx
165 static inline void pxa_ac97_warm_pxa3xx(void)
166 {
167 	int timeout = 100;
168 
169 	gsr_bits = 0;
170 
171 	/* Can't use interrupts */
172 	GCR |= GCR_WARM_RST;
173 	while (!((GSR | gsr_bits) & (GSR_PCR | GSR_SCR)) && timeout--)
174 		mdelay(1);
175 }
176 
177 static inline void pxa_ac97_cold_pxa3xx(void)
178 {
179 	int timeout = 1000;
180 
181 	/* Hold CLKBPB for 100us */
182 	GCR = 0;
183 	GCR = GCR_CLKBPB;
184 	udelay(100);
185 	GCR = 0;
186 
187 	GCR &=  GCR_COLD_RST;  /* clear everything but nCRST */
188 	GCR &= ~GCR_COLD_RST;  /* then assert nCRST */
189 
190 	gsr_bits = 0;
191 
192 	/* Can't use interrupts on PXA3xx */
193 	GCR &= ~(GCR_PRIRDY_IEN|GCR_SECRDY_IEN);
194 
195 	GCR = GCR_WARM_RST | GCR_COLD_RST;
196 	while (!(GSR & (GSR_PCR | GSR_SCR)) && timeout--)
197 		mdelay(10);
198 }
199 #endif

274 static irqreturn_t pxa2xx_ac97_irq(int irq, void *dev_id)
275 {
276 	long status;
277 
278 	status = GSR;
279 	if (status) {
280 		GSR = status;
281 		gsr_bits |= status;
282 		wake_up(&gsr_wq);
283 
284 		/* Although we don't use those we still need to clear them
285 		   since they tend to spuriously trigger when MMC is used
286 		   (hardware bug? go figure)... */
287 		if (cpu_is_pxa27x()) {
288 			MISR = MISR_EOC;
289 			PISR = PISR_EOC;
290 			MCSR = MCSR_EOC;
291 		}
292 
293 		return IRQ_HANDLED;
294 	}
295 
296 	return IRQ_NONE;
297 }
